Tent Oven Safety Tips
Camping tent cooktops can be a convenient method to prepare in the comfort of your outdoor tents, but only when they're utilized securely. Correct use of a camping tent oven lowers the risk of carbon monoxide poisoning and fire risk.

To reduce these dangers, remember the adhering to outdoor tents stove security ideas:

See To It Your Tent Is Fireproof
Camping tents are constructed from combustible material and must be kept at least several feet away from open ranges. They must additionally be positioned upwind and away from any type of ground particles that can easily ignite.

Make certain that your outdoor tents is designed to fit an oven, and always utilize a flame-resistant cooktop mat. This produces an obstacle in between the hot cooktop and the flooring of your tent, significantly reducing the threat of fire.

Avoid storing highly combustible items inside your camping tent, consisting of insect repellent, butane containers, and food preparation oils. Additionally, maintain your water storage tank a risk-free range from the cooktop to stop it from falling on you and causing extreme, unpleasant 1st level burns. Ultimately, make certain to cleanse your trigger arrestor consistently to lower creosote build-up.

Maintain Combustibles Far From Your Cooktop
Whether you're camping in the backcountry or glamping at a deluxe camping site, an outdoor tents cooktop supplies a large amount of convenience and capability. Nonetheless, it is necessary to recognize outdoor tents cooktop safety and security to maintain on your own and others risk-free from fire risks, carbon monoxide poisoning and more.

Keep flammable things such as pot holders, towels and drapes a risk-free distance far from your cooktop. Additionally, prevent plugging a lot of heat-producing home appliances-- like toasters, electrical fry pans or coffee pots-- into the same electrical outlet or circuit. This can overload your circuit, overheat and create a fire.

Along with maintaining a clear area around your range, you should clean the cooktop and oven pipe routinely to remove accumulation of ash and creosote. This minimizes the danger of fire and also helps to make certain appropriate ventilation, avoiding carbon monoxide poisoning.

Know the Very Early Warning Signs of Danger
When using an outdoor tents oven, it is very important to be familiar with the potential fire threats. It's additionally vital to understand the early indication that can aid avoid a disaster from taking place.

It's important to keep combustible products like bug spray, butane canisters, and aerosol like sunscreen away from your outdoor tents oven. These can explode when revealed to heats, and they can trigger serious injuries if they enter into contact with fires or hot surface areas.

Stoves commonly have to be placed in limited spaces in outdoors tents, particularly in backpacking situations where room goes to a premium. When this is done inaccurately, it can produce a fire hazard or carbon monoxide gas poisoning danger for campers. Be sure to review your maker's instructions and adhere to suggested safety and security procedures when preparing and positioning your oven in your camping tent.

Maintain a Fire Extinguisher handy
Tent cooktops can supply a lot of ease and comfort when outdoor camping. Nevertheless, they likewise present some dangers otherwise made use of properly. These consist of carbon monoxide poisoning, smoke breathing, and fires. To lessen these hazards, constantly follow expert outdoor tents range safety and security suggestions like correct ventilation, cleaning, and hunting tent understanding of early warning signs of danger.

Maintain a multipurpose completely dry chemical fire extinguisher at hand. This is the most effective type of extinguisher for tent ovens as it can put out both combustible and combustible products. Also, see to it you use it appropriately by aiming the nozzle reduced towards the base of the oven from a safe range away and squeezing the operating bar.

Last but not least, you ought to always clean your trigger arrestor frequently. Clogged up spark arrestors can trigger smoke to leave your range door and might lead to an oven pipeline fire.

Know Exactly How to Produce a Fire
Tent ranges are a remarkable tool for camping, however they can be unsafe if used improperly. Whether you're backpacking solo in the backcountry or glamping with a team of loved ones, understanding camping tent cooktop security is crucial.

When shopping for a new outdoor tents stove, try to find one with a high-quality door that produces a closed seal. This permits you to manage the dimension and strength of your fire, improving combustion and aiding to keep your camping tent at a secure temperature.

Be sure to clean your oven consistently to prevent a build-up of residue and ash. This can obstruct the circulation of smoke, raising levels of carbon monoxide and presenting a severe fire threat. Also, be sure your range hinges on a heat-resistant system as opposed to straight on the floor of your tent.
